[gentoo-dev] Re: [gentoo-commits] repo/gentoo:master commit in: dev-java/bcprov/

2015-10-09 Thread Michał Górny
Dnia 2015-10-08, o godz. 22:11:12
"Patrice Clement"  napisał(a):

> commit: 82be4dfc08bacbac9814583a840bb1d2fd59
> Author: Patrice Clement  gentoo  org>
> AuthorDate: Thu Oct  8 22:02:48 2015 +
> Commit: Patrice Clement  gentoo  org>
> CommitDate: Thu Oct  8 22:06:19 2015 +
> UR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=82be4dfc
> 
> dev-java/bcprov: Clean up old.
> 
> Package-Manager: portage-2.2.20.1
> Signed-off-by: Patrice Clement  gentoo.org>
> 
>  dev-java/bcprov/Manifest  |  3 --
>  dev-java/bcprov/bcprov-1.38-r2.ebuild | 57 
>  dev-java/bcprov/bcprov-1.38-r3.ebuild | 57 
>  dev-java/bcprov/bcprov-1.40-r1.ebuild | 59 
>  dev-java/bcprov/bcprov-1.45-r1.ebuild | 59 
>  dev-java/bcprov/bcprov-1.45.ebuild| 59 
>  dev-java/bcprov/bcprov-1.48-r1.ebuild | 64 --
>  dev-java/bcprov/bcprov-1.49-r2.ebuild | 81 -
>  dev-java/bcprov/bcprov-1.49-r3.ebuild | 81 -
>  dev-java/bcprov/bcprov-1.50-r1.ebuild | 58 
>  dev-java/bcprov/bcprov-1.50.ebuild| 81 -
>  dev-java/bcprov/bcprov-1.52.ebuild| 84 
> ---
>  12 files changed, 743 deletions(-)

Replying to one of the particularly influential commits in long batch
of wrongdoing.

So here you remove all of the ebuild which have SLOT="0", effectively
breaking *stable* dev-java/bcmail, dev-java/bcpkix, dev-java/itext:

https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l59
https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l153
https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l249
https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l343
https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l710

What's even worse, you instantly stabilize new dev-java/bcmail ebuilds
which have the same issue.

As a side issue, why the hell do you stabilize a number of random old
versions? This does not like a sane solution, instantly adding dozen
of poorly-tested middle versions into the stable tree.

-- 
Best regards,
Michał Górny



pgpOnbWIVggMa.pgp
Description: OpenPGP digital signature


[gentoo-dev] Re: [gentoo-commits] repo/gentoo:master commit in: dev-java/bcprov/

2015-10-09 Thread Patrice Clement
Friday 09 Oct 2015 08:28:06, Michał Górny wrote :
> Dnia 2015-10-08, o godz. 22:11:12
> "Patrice Clement"  napisał(a):
> 
> > commit: 82be4dfc08bacbac9814583a840bb1d2fd59
> > Author: Patrice Clement  gentoo  org>
> > AuthorDate: Thu Oct  8 22:02:48 2015 +
> > Commit: Patrice Clement  gentoo  org>
> > CommitDate: Thu Oct  8 22:06:19 2015 +
> > UR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=82be4dfc
> > 
> > dev-java/bcprov: Clean up old.
> > 
> > Package-Manager: portage-2.2.20.1
> > Signed-off-by: Patrice Clement  gentoo.org>
> > 
> >  dev-java/bcprov/Manifest  |  3 --
> >  dev-java/bcprov/bcprov-1.38-r2.ebuild | 57 
> >  dev-java/bcprov/bcprov-1.38-r3.ebuild | 57 
> >  dev-java/bcprov/bcprov-1.40-r1.ebuild | 59 
> >  dev-java/bcprov/bcprov-1.45-r1.ebuild | 59 
> >  dev-java/bcprov/bcprov-1.45.ebuild| 59 
> >  dev-java/bcprov/bcprov-1.48-r1.ebuild | 64 --
> >  dev-java/bcprov/bcprov-1.49-r2.ebuild | 81 
> > -
> >  dev-java/bcprov/bcprov-1.49-r3.ebuild | 81 
> > -
> >  dev-java/bcprov/bcprov-1.50-r1.ebuild | 58 
> >  dev-java/bcprov/bcprov-1.50.ebuild| 81 
> > -
> >  dev-java/bcprov/bcprov-1.52.ebuild| 84 
> > ---
> >  12 files changed, 743 deletions(-)
> 
> Replying to one of the particularly influential commits in long batch
> of wrongdoing.
> 
> So here you remove all of the ebuild which have SLOT="0", effectively
> breaking *stable* dev-java/bcmail, dev-java/bcpkix, dev-java/itext:
> 
> https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l59
> https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l153
> https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l249
> https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l343
> https://qa-reports.gentoo.org/output/gentoo-ci/62d6c0c/6.html#l710
> 
> What's even worse, you instantly stabilize new dev-java/bcmail ebuilds
> which have the same issue.
> 
> As a side issue, why the hell do you stabilize a number of random old
> versions? This does not like a sane solution, instantly adding dozen
> of poorly-tested middle versions into the stable tree.
> 
> -- 
> Best regards,
> Michał Górny
> 

bcprov ebuilds were a clusterfuck that I was trying to fix and obviously I
failed. Taking a look at it right now. Fix underway.

-- 
Patrice Clement
Gentoo Linux developer
http://www.gentoo.org


signature.asc
Description: PGP signature